A PARALLEL HOUSEHOLDER TRIDIAGONALIZATION STRATAGEM USING SCATTERED ROW DECOMPOSITION

被引:4
作者
CHANG, HY
UTKU, S
SALAMA, M
RAPP, D
机构
[1] DUKE UNIV,DEPT CIVIL ENGN,DURHAM,NC 27706
[2] DUKE UNIV,DEPT COMP SCI,DURHAM,NC 27706
[3] CALTECH,JET PROP LAB,PASADENA,CA 91109
关键词
COMPUTER PROGRAMMING - Algorithms - MATHEMATICAL TECHNIQUES - Eigenvalues and Eigenfunctions;
D O I
10.1002/nme.1620260408
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
Householder's method for tridiagonalizing a real symmetric matrix, a major step in evaluating eigenvalues of the matrix, is modified into a parallel algorithm for a concurrent machine of message passing type. Each processor of the concurrent machine has its own CPU, communications control and local memory. Messages are passed through connections between processors. Although the basic algorithm is inherently serial, the computations can be spread over all processors by scattering different rows of the matrix into processors, hence the term 'Scattered Row Decomposition'. The steps in the serial and the parallel algorithms are identified. Expressions for efficiency and speedup are given in terms of problem and machine parameters. For a concurrent machine of ring type interconnection, a selected representative problem of large order exhibits efficiency approaching 66 per cent.
引用
收藏
页码:857 / 873
页数:17
相关论文
共 4 条
[1]  
Burden RL, 1981, NUMERICAL ANAL
[2]  
Hwang K., 1984, COMPUTER ARCHITECTUR
[3]  
ORTEGA J, 1967, MATH METHOD DIGITAL
[4]  
Wilkinson J. H., 1965, ALGEBRAIC EIGENVALUE